Sleeping At Last Wheaton, Illinois

Sleeping At Last is Chicago-based singer-songwriter, producer and composer, Ryan O’Neal. His upcoming release Atlas: Year Two consists of 25 singles to be released throughout 2015-2016, highlighting the themes of Life, Senses, Emotions, Intelligence, and Enneagram.

SAL's music is frequently heard on popular TV Shows and Film like Grey’s Anatomy, Criminal Minds, Bones, and Astronaut Wives Club.
